Output 3bed3f061923f617390d0661e2fd0b1c40905453d02152eef314297ce2004c04:10

value
55914
script pubkey
OP_0 OP_PUSHBYTES_20 59bd1169964b3f7a3b3e98e9fe4507f44b39c058
address
bc1qtx73z6vkfvlh5we7nr5lu3g8739nnszcfdsdkr
transaction
3bed3f061923f617390d0661e2fd0b1c40905453d02152eef314297ce2004c04
confirmations
187622
spent
true